网络安全技术是保护计算机网络不受攻击和破坏的一系列技术和方法。这些技术可以分为以下几类:
1. 防火墙:防火墙是一种网络安全设备,用于监控和控制进出网络的数据流。它可以根据预设的规则和策略,决定哪些数据包可以进入或离开网络,从而防止未经授权的访问和恶意攻击。防火墙还可以检测和阻止潜在的安全威胁,如DDoS攻击和恶意软件传播。
2. 入侵检测:入侵检测是一种主动防御技术,用于实时监控网络活动,以便在发现潜在的安全威胁时立即采取行动。入侵检测系统(IDS)可以分析网络流量,识别异常行为,并报告给管理员。IDS通常结合使用其他安全技术,如防火墙、加密技术和身份验证,以提供全面的网络安全保护。
3. 加密技术:加密技术是一种确保数据机密性和完整性的技术,用于保护传输中和存储中的敏感信息。常见的加密技术包括对称加密(如AES)、非对称加密(如RSA)和哈希函数(如MD5)。加密技术可以防止数据在传输过程中被窃取或篡改,同时也可以确保数据的完整性,防止数据被篡改或损坏。
4. 身份验证:身份验证是一种确保用户和设备身份的技术,用于防止未授权访问和欺诈行为。身份验证技术包括密码学身份验证(如密码、数字证书和双因素认证)、生物特征身份验证(如指纹、虹膜和面部识别)和智能卡身份验证(如智能卡和电子护照)。身份验证技术可以确保只有经过授权的用户和设备才能访问网络资源,从而提高网络安全性。
总之,网络安全技术主要包括防火墙、入侵检测、加密技术和身份验证。这些技术相互补充,共同构成了一个多层次的网络安全体系,旨在保护网络免受各种安全威胁,确保网络的稳定运行和数据的安全。